Flow limiter

[1] Some designs use single stage or multi-stage orifice plates to handle high and low flow rates.

An example is manufacturing facilities and laboratories using flow limiters to prevent injury or death from noxious gases that are in use.

Flow limiters are designed with the intent of reducing the cross-section area with a plate and a laser drill is used to create a small hole.

The disadvantage to the porous media design is the poor removal of particles and a drop in pressure.

Stainless steel has the material strength to withstand high pressures and resists chemical corrosion.
